Acetal vs Nylon: Key Differences, Properties, and Applications

Acetal vs nylon is a common engineering plastic comparison because both materials are widely used for gears, bushings, bearings, fasteners, rollers, housings, and CNC machined components. Acetal is usually selected for dimensional stability, low friction, moisture resistance, and clean machining, while nylon is chosen for toughness, impact resistance, abrasion resistance, and cost-effective mechanical strength.
